Portable navigation devices offer undeniable convenience, yet they can become distractions if not managed properly. Start with deliberate setup before you move: mount the device where you can glance without twisting your torso or taking your eyes off the road for more than a fraction of a second. Use voice prompts and large, high-contrast screens, and adjust font sizes so you do not strain to read while cruising. Preload routes, check for traffic incidents, and confirm essential turns before approaching intersections. By planning ahead, you reduce the need to fiddle with controls during critical moments and keep your hands, eyes, and mental load focused on safe operation.
Beyond placement and preloading, the essential principle is to minimize manual interaction. Whenever possible, activate features through hands-free commands, steering-wheel controls, or voice assistant prompts that comply with local laws. If you must interact with the device, do so only while the vehicle is stationary or in a clearly safe context such as a pullout or parking area. Regularly update software to improve voice recognition and reduce misinterpretations that could lead to dangerous maneuvers. Remember that every moment of manual input draws attention from the road, and even a brief distraction can have outsized consequences on speed, reaction time, and situational awareness.

A robust setup reduces cognitive load during navigation tasks. Choose a mounting location within your line of sight that does not obscure essential instrument clusters or hinder airbags. The screen should be angled for quick glances rather than prolonged focus. Use a single, reliable mounting method and periodically inspect and tighten the mount to prevent device fallout. Consistency matters: if you switch between devices or mounts, you risk adopting new, unfamiliar interactions that slow your response time. By establishing a repeatable routine, you create muscle memory that supports safer, more automatic behaviors behind the wheel.

When route instructions are unclear or traffic demands sudden changes, rely on spoken directions first. Training your ear to interpret voice prompts reduces the urge to fumble with the screen under pressure. If you expect to be diverted, enable a proactive alert mode that announces changes early, so you have time to reorient without looking away. Keep critical settings, such as volume and amplification, tuned to avoid shouting or misinterpretation. The goal is clarity, not complexity; simple, consistent commands help you maintain control of steering, speed, and lane positioning.

Education is a foundational pillar of responsible device use in traffic. Drivers should learn the specific hands-free requirements in their jurisdiction, including limits on device handling, permissible mounting heights, and the legality of voice-activated navigation. Employers and fleet operators can reinforce compliance through regular briefings and practical demonstrations. Training should emphasize how to activate, adjust, and cancel routes without removing hands from the wheel. Coupling training with periodic refreshers helps prevent drift into hazardous habits when fatigue, weather, or high-pressure driving scenarios arise.

Equally important is maintaining awareness of surroundings rather than becoming engrossed in the device. Even when the route is straightforward, typical driving hazards persist: cyclists weaving through lanes, merging traffic, inattentive pedestrians, and changing road surfaces. Develop a habit of scanning the environment before and after any instruction change. Use the device only as a support tool, not a substitute for observation. If you notice your attention drifting, take a deliberate pause to re-engage with the road and re-evaluate your plan, ensuring that your navigation aids augment rather than impede your safety.

In mixed driving conditions, such as rush hour or dusk, adopt a conservative approach to device interaction. Reduce reliance on complex features during peak traffic and postpone screen interactions until clear, stable conditions permit safe execution. Preconfigure routes for common destinations and select the simplest, most direct path available. If you must re-route, defer nonessential confirmations until you are outside dense traffic zones. The essence of responsible navigation is predictable behavior: drivers know what to expect from your actions, which increases overall road safety for everyone sharing the roadway.
Equity between safety and efficiency should guide your decisions about device features. Favor hands-free input methods over manual taps, and favor audio feedback over lingering screen lookups. Close your eyes to the urge to multitask beyond reasonable limits; even routine tasks can escalate into errors under stress. Modern devices provide redundancy—shifting to a backup audio cue or a coarse turn cue can help you maintain momentum without compromising control. The right balance is achieved when the device becomes a quiet partner that reduces cognitive load without demanding attention in unsafe ways.

Fleet-wide policies can reinforce safe navigation practices through clear expectations and accountability. Companies should specify acceptable devices, mounting standards, and permissible interaction types, while drivers should commit to a consistent routine that respects those standards. Regular audits, simulated drills, and feedback loops help cement safe behaviors as habits rather than exceptions. When new devices or apps enter the workflow, provide hands-on training and validate that all features work with minimal manual intervention. A well-defined protocol reduces ambiguity and supports steady, compliant performance behind the wheel.
It is crucial to consider varying road types and regulatory landscapes across regions. Rural roads, urban corridors, and highway interchanges each demand different degrees of attention and device interaction. Always check for regional laws about hold practices, glove usage, and screen visibility under bright sun or heavy rain. If you operate in multiple jurisdictions, maintain a quick-reference guide with the key rules that affect how navigation tools may be used. This proactive approach helps prevent unintended violations and reinforces a culture of safety and respect for local rules.
In parallel with technical discipline, cultivate a personal habit of periodic self-checks before every trip. Quick mental rehearsals about where and how you will interact with the device can prevent impulsive actions. Take a moment to assess weather, traffic density, and fatigue levels; if any factor seems unfavorable, adjust your plan accordingly or delay nonessential interactions. Such pre-briefing supports steady decision-making and reduces the likelihood of hands-on navigation at moments that demand full attention.
